Historical & Cultural Background

The name Ana has its roots in the Hebrew name Channah, meaning "grace" or "favor." This name was transliterated into Greek as Anna and subsequently into Latin, maintaining its form as Anna. The name entered the English language through Old French, where it was adopted as Anne, which is a variant of Ana. The evolution of the name reflects a journey through various cultures and languages, illustrating its enduring appeal across different societies.

Historically, the name Ana has been associated with several significant figures. In the Christian tradition, Anna is recognized as the mother of the Virgin Mary, making her a prominent figure in biblical narratives. This association is particularly notable in the New Testament, where she is mentioned in the context of the Nativity story. The name has also been borne by various saints throughout the centuries, contributing to its religious significance. The name Anna appears in early Christian texts and was popularized in the Middle Ages, especially in Europe, where it was often used in various forms, including Ana, Anne, and Ann.

Culturally, the name Ana has resonated through literature, art, and religious contexts. It symbolizes grace and favor, qualities that have made it a cherished name in many cultures. The name has been celebrated in various artistic works, including literature and music, further embedding it in cultural consciousness. Additionally, diminutive forms such as Annie or Anya have emerged, reflecting the name's adaptability and continued relevance in different linguistic and cultural contexts. Overall, Ana's historical and cultural significance underscores its lasting legacy across time and geography.

U.S. Historical Usage

The name Ana was first seen in the United States in 1880. Ana has ranked as high as #242 nationally, which occurred in 1991, and has been most popular in California, Texas, New York, Florida, and Illinois. In the past 5 years the name Ana has been trending down compared to the previous 5 years.
